Mr. Lavarias is an active bassoonist and he performs as an orchestral player, a chamber  and solo bassoonist and covers a wide variety of genres. He is a founding member of the Cardinal Sound Collective, a flexible woodwind ensemble based in Greensboro with a focus on underrepresented composers and community engagement. In addition to his work as a bassoonist, he also has experience in teaching music theory.
